The Importance of Comprehensive Training
Paramedics play a critical role in emergency healthcare, serving as the frontline responders in life-threatening situations. Comprehensive training is essential to equip them with the skills necessary to handle diverse medical emergencies effectively. This training not only focuses on clinical skills but also emphasizes the importance of communication, decision-making, and teamwork, which are crucial in high-pressure environments. Effective training ensures paramedics can assess patients quickly, provide immediate care, and transport them safely to medical facilities. This multi-faceted approach to training prepares them to respond efficiently to emergencies while maintaining a calm demeanor, instilling confidence in both the paramedics and the patients they serve.
Integration of Technology in Paramedic Training
With the rapid advancement of technology, modern paramedic training programs increasingly incorporate innovative tools to enhance learning outcomes. Virtual simulations, for instance, offer realistic scenarios where trainees can practice their skills in a controlled environment. These simulations help paramedics refine their critical thinking and decision-making skills without the risks associated with real-life emergencies.
Additionally, the use of mobile applications allows paramedics to access vital information on-the-go, such as drug dosages or advanced life support protocols. This technological integration not only improves the training process but also prepares paramedics for the digital landscape of modern healthcare, ensuring they are adept at utilizing these tools in the field.
Hands-on Clinical Experience
While theoretical knowledge is essential, hands-on clinical experience is invaluable for aspiring paramedics. This practical training allows students to apply what they have learned in real-world situations, developing their skills and confidence. Clinical rotations in hospitals and with ambulance services are often integral components of paramedic training programs, providing exposure to a variety of medical scenarios.
During these rotations, paramedics can learn from seasoned professionals, gaining insights into best practices and advanced techniques. This mentorship is crucial, as it helps shape their approach to patient care and enhances their ability to work collaboratively within healthcare teams.
Continuous Education and Skills Assessment
The field of emergency medical services is constantly evolving, necessitating ongoing education for paramedics. Continuous training and skills assessments are crucial to ensure that paramedics remain competent in their roles and are up-to-date with the latest protocols and technologies. Many organizations mandate regular refresher courses and training workshops to facilitate this ongoing development.
This commitment to lifelong learning not only improves patient care outcomes but also instills a sense of professionalism and dedication among paramedics. By fostering an environment of continuous improvement, paramedic services can enhance their operational efficiency and responsiveness to the community’s healthcare needs.
